Hi, I have just British Gas engineers to service my Intergas Boiler. After 15mins looking at the boiler, I was told that the seals should be changed every 4yrs and the parts had been sent to someone else and that they were covering the job.
My question is I've never been told that the seals needed changing before and why was it mentioned today? I've had my boiler serviced since I moved in 5yrs ago and this has never been mentioned before. Can anyone please tell me what's going on?
Regards Dave

My Vaillant is the same. Should be every 4/5 years. I’ve had it nearly 9 years now. Definitely going to have the full strip down service this year……

Deep Strip-Down (Every 4–5 Years)
    • Heat Exchanger Inspection: Vaillant ecoTEC models benefit from a deeper strip-down service every 4 to 5 years to scrub and flush internal carbon scaling from the primary heat exchanger.
    • Seal Replacements: Replacing the burner door seal, gaskets, and washer components whenever the combustion chamber is opened
